On Tuesday 17 June 2014 10:02 PM, Lee Jones wrote:
> On Wed, 28 May 2014, Keerthy wrote:
>
>> Shift the reg_info structure definition to the header file.
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Keerthy <j-keerthy@ti.com>
>> ---
>> drivers/regulator/palmas-regulator.c | 9 ---------
>> include/linux/mfd/palmas.h | 9 +++++++++
>> 2 files changed, 9 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)
> Patch looks fine. I guess we'll wait and pull the entire set in once
> it's ready.
>
> Acked-by: Lee Jones <lee.jones@linaro.org>
Thanks.
>
>> diff --git a/drivers/regulator/palmas-regulator.c b/drivers/regulator/palmas-regulator.c
>> index 9602eba..d41f3de 100644
>> --- a/drivers/regulator/palmas-regulator.c
>> +++ b/drivers/regulator/palmas-regulator.c
>> @@ -27,15 +27,6 @@
>> #include <linux/of_platform.h>
>> #include <linux/regulator/of_regulator.h>
>>
>> -struct regs_info {
>> - char *name;
>> - char *sname;
>> - u8 vsel_addr;
>> - u8 ctrl_addr;
>> - u8 tstep_addr;
>> - int sleep_id;
>> -};
>> -
>> static const struct regulator_linear_range smps_low_ranges[] = {
>> REGULATOR_LINEAR_RANGE(500000, 0x1, 0x6, 0),
>> REGULATOR_LINEAR_RANGE(510000, 0x7, 0x79, 10000),
>> diff --git a/include/linux/mfd/palmas.h b/include/linux/mfd/palmas.h
>> index 52a24a9..150a6314 100644
>> --- a/include/linux/mfd/palmas.h
>> +++ b/include/linux/mfd/palmas.h
>> @@ -88,6 +88,15 @@ struct palmas {
>> u8 pwm_muxed;
>> };
>>
>> +struct regs_info {
>> + char *name;
>> + char *sname;
>> + u8 vsel_addr;
>> + u8 ctrl_addr;
>> + u8 tstep_addr;
>> + int sleep_id;
>> +};
>> +
>> struct palmas_gpadc_platform_data {
>> /* Channel 3 current source is only enabled during conversion */
>> int ch3_current;
